WESTWARD WOMAN;S INSTITUTE.

   At the March meeting each member had the privilege  of inviting a friend.
The president introduced Miss. PETTY of London ("the  Pudding Lady), who gave
a demonstration on cookery. She was accorded a hearty  vote of thanks, on
proposition of Mrs. ROPER, seconded by Miss. GARNER. There  were 54 entries for a
baking competition, in which eight prizes were given.  These were judged by
Miss. PETTY and the following were the prize winners:
